Beef and Lamb Cooking Temperature Chart
Roasts, Steaks & Chops
Rare
120 to 125 degrees F
center is bright red, pinkish toward the exterior portion
Medium Rare
130 to 135 degrees F
center is very pink, slightly brown toward the exterior portion
Medium
140 to 145 degrees F
center is light pink, outer portion is brown
Medium Well
150 to 155 degrees F
not pink
Well Done
160 degrees F and above
steak is uniformly brown throughout
Ground Meat
160 to 165 degrees F
no longer pink but uniformly brown throughout
